Enhanced Security Advantages Offered by Automated Gate Systems
Automated entry barriers serve as a strong defense against unauthorized access by utilizing advanced locking systems and remote control features. These automated gates discourage opportunistic intruders and enhance the overall security of the property. Integrated surveillance tools like intercoms and cameras provide extra levels of monitoring and verification. Smooth and effective operations reduce the risk period, providing safe entry and exit for both residents and visitors.
- Always integrate motorised gate systems with access control and surveillance for layered security
- Use encrypted wireless protocols to prevent gate signal interception and hacking
- Regularly update the gate’s firmware to address security vulnerabilities and improve protective features
- Install anti-tailgating sensors to identify and stop unauthorized vehicles that attempt to enter by closely following other cars through the gate
- Choose gates with automatic locking mechanisms that engage during power failures for continuous protection

Steps for Installing Automatic Entryways
Installing automated access barriers demands thorough planning, precise measurement, and assessment of entry locations. Technicians set up actuators and control panels, ensuring seamless integration with safety sensors and remote triggers. Wiring is carefully concealed to prevent disruption to landscaping or existing infrastructure and to ensure reliable connectivity. The final calibration process includes thorough testing of obstacle detection, response times, and manual override functions to ensure dependable performance.

Safety Features of Modern Gate Operators
Automated entry systems now use photoelectric sensors that immediately stop movement when they detect an obstruction. Integrated audio alarms and flashing lights alert those nearby to movement, reducing the risk of surprise encounters. Emergency manual release systems guarantee continued access in the event of power failures or malfunctions. Sophisticated encryption and rolling code technology prevent unauthorized efforts to penetrate perimeter security.
